Control Huggy Wuggy with a single tap or click. The character automatically rockets forward, and each tap makes him bounce higher to dodge obstacles. The sky scrolls constantly, forcing you to react in real time. Points rack up the longer you stay airborne, and each planet you skim adds a bonus multiplier. Mastering Huggy Wuggy in Space isn’t just about quick reflexes; it’s about timing your bounces to skim the edge of each planet. Start by staying close to the lower half of the screen; this gives you more reaction time against incoming obstacles. As you collect streak bonuses, gradually lift your flight path toward the sky—higher altitude means higher point multipliers but also tighter gaps. In 2 Player Games, watch your opponent’s pattern and force them into a risky bounce; a well‑placed Rocket boost can turn the tide instantly. Keep an eye on the “bounce meter”: a fully charged meter lets you execute a super‑bounce that clears clusters of planets in one go. Finally, use the pause button to analyze the next segment; a split‑second decision can add hundreds of points.
